AdGuyMG Posted January 23, 2017 #2 Share Posted January 23, 2017 (edited) https://help.carnival.com/app/answers/detail/a_id/1106/~/cheers%21-beverage-program CHEERS! is non-refundable; if the program is purchased prior to the cruise, it is refundable up to 11:59pm ET, the evening prior to the cruise departure. This tells me the No Show gets no refund. If they cancelled Cheers up until midnight the day before they will get a refund. But that cancels Cheers for the remaining passenger and the remaining passenger would have to purchase Cheers on the ship after it sails at the $5 per day higher rate. Still a good deal.
